Probe ‘illegal acts’ by weaving societies

Special Correspondent


Former MLA moves Madras High Court seeking a direction


CHENNAI: A former MLA has moved the Madras High Court seeking a direction to the Assistant Director of Handlooms and Textiles, Erode, to enquire into the “illegal acts” by some weaving societies in Chennimalai Union block in Erode.

In his petition, filed by counsel A.N. Thambidurai, P. Marappan of Kangeyam in Tirupur district said the societies were not functioning properly and indulged in “misappropriation, fraudulent retention of money, breach of trust and corrupt practices.”

They enrolled fictitious members and sold thread to non-members.

The petitioner, an advocate in Erode district, said he had sent representations in September and October this year to authorities seeking an enquiry. No action was taken.

The court has ordered notice returnable in four weeks.
